We’ve invested in cutting-edge reverse osmosis and de-ionisation systems, producing pure water by removing all minerals and impurities. This pure water allows us to clean not only your windows but also the frames, sills, and doors, ensuring a cobweb-free and streak-free finish every time. After cleaning, we rinse the windows and leave them to dry naturally, providing the best results with no residue or chemicals.
Using the water-fed pole system provides numerous benefits for your property:
- Clean windows at height without ladders, ensuring both your privacy and property are respected
- Reach awkward windows, such as those above conservatories or garages
- Effectively clean UPVC frames and sills, delivering a comprehensive clean every time
- No chemicals or soaps used—just pure, eco-friendly water
Traditional window cleaning refers to the classic, hands-on method of cleaning windows that many homeowners and businesses still prefer today. This technique involves a combination of squeegees, scrapers, and cloths to manually clean both the interior and exterior of windows, leaving them streak-free and sparkling.
Key Equipment Used in Traditional Window Cleaning:
- Squeegee
The most iconic tool in traditional window cleaning, the squeegee is used to remove water and cleaning solution from the window’s surface using a rubber blade that ensures a streak-free finish as it’s pulled down the glass. - Window Cleaning Solution
A specially formulated liquid cleaner is applied to the windows before using the squeegee. - Extension Poles
For out-of-reach windows, especially on higher floors, extension poles are used to attach the squeegee and cleaning cloth. This allows the window cleaner to access windows at height hopefully without the need for ladders - Scrapers
A window scraper is used to remove tougher debris, like bird droppings, paint splatters, or tree sap. The scraper has a razor blade that gently scrapes away these stubborn residues without scratching the glass. It’s an essential tool for dealing with sticky or hard-to-remove dirt. - Microfiber Cloths or Towels
After using the squeegee, microfiber cloths or towels are used to wipe down the edges of the windows to prevent water spots. Microfiber is ideal because it’s highly absorbent, doesn’t leave lint, and helps buff the glass to a polished shine. It’s also commonly used for detailing around the frames and sills. - Buckets
A large, sturdy bucket is used to hold the window cleaning solution and water. - Ladders
For windows that are at a higher level we often use ladders for access. While ladder usage requires safety precautions, it’s still a common tool for cleaning windows on the ground floor or upper stories of homes and buildings upon our visit to you we can walk through what is possible and what windows may be more challenging. - Safety Equipment
For cleaning windows at height, safety harnesses, ropes, and ladder stabilizers are sometimes used to ensure the cleaner’s safety. This is particularly important when working on tall buildings or in areas where the risk of falling is a concern. The team will following their RAMS and Method statements.
